The Cost-Effectiveness of Chlorothalonil and Thiophanate Methyl in Agriculture


In the realm of modern agriculture, the quest for effective pest and disease management solutions is continuous. Two fungicides that have garnered attention for their efficacy and relatively affordable pricing are chlorothalonil and thiophanate methyl. These compounds serve distinct purposes and present unique advantages that make them valuable assets for farmers striving to protect their crops.


Chlorothalonil is a broad-spectrum fungicide renowned for its ability to combat a variety of fungal pathogens. It works by interfering with the production of cellular components in fungi, effectively hindering their growth and reproduction. One of the most significant benefits of chlorothalonil is its cost-effectiveness; it is often more affordable than many alternative fungicides. This affordability is crucial for farmers, especially those operating on tight budgets. The economic pressure to maximize yields while minimizing costs often leads farmers to seek out effective solutions that don’t break the bank. Chlorothalonil fits this criterion, making it a popular choice in various agricultural sectors, including fruit and vegetable production.


On the other hand, thiophanate methyl is another key player in the fungicide market. This systemic fungicide offers both preventive and curative properties against a wide range of diseases, such as powdery mildew and black rot. Thiophanate methyl functions by disrupting the fungal cell division process, effectively stopping the spread of infections already present in crops. Its versatility and effectiveness can lead to significant economic benefits for farmers, as healthy plants typically yield more produce. The affordability of thiophanate methyl, combined with its efficiency in disease management, ensures that farmers can maintain crop health without incurring exorbitant costs.

When comparing the two fungicides, it is essential to consider their respective application methods and environmental impact. Chlorothalonil is often applied as a protective measure, covering crops before infection peaks, whereas thiophanate methyl can be utilized both preventively and curatively. This dual-functionality means that farmers can use thiophanate methyl not only to protect against future infections but also to treat existing issues, thus potentially reducing the number of applications required throughout the growing season.


Ultimately, the choice between chlorothalonil and thiophanate methyl may come down to specific crop needs, local pest pressures, and environmental considerations. Both fungicides offer a cost-effective way to manage plant diseases effectively, helping to ensure agricultural productivity and sustainability.
